450 Mira Elikopteron
Role: Patrol, target-tug and assault

450 Mira Elikopteron (Helicopter Squadron) was formerly part of Mira Elikopteron-Aeroskafon, before it was split into two in May 2002. The unit comprises two platoons, operating the fixed-wing aircraft and Mi-35 Hind respectively.

1st Platoon
Patrol & target-tug unit.
